What is Mommy Makeover and How Does it Work in New Orleans?

Mommy makeover is a bunch of body contouring procedures that are done to help you restore the body that you had before you got pregnant since pregnancy could do a lot of things to your body naturally that may or may not affect the way you see yourself. 

Every woman’s mommy makeover looks different since everybody’s body is not the same and you are going to have these specific things that you want to change about yourself to achieve your personal goals. 

Usually, procedures like tummy tuck, breast augmentation, and liposuctions are the procedures that women often request for their makeovers. All of them are done in one surgery most of the time.

Who Can Be a Candidate for a Mommy Makeover in New Orleans?

You are the perfect candidate for a mommy makeover in New Orleans if you are already close to your weight goal, don’t smoke and drink, are generally healthy, your child-bearing days are over, and you have stopped breastfeeding 6 months ago, and you have given birth 6 months ago. 

You are going to have to collaborate with your surgeon to make sure that you get the procedures done that you want to be done, and these procedures are safe for you and your future plans. 

If you plan on getting another baby, then maybe you are going to have to wait until you have that child before you think of getting a mommy makeover because this could undo all of the work done beforehand, which would be kind of pointless.

Why Do Most Women Undergo a Mommy Makeover in New Orleans?

Pregnancy naturally changes your body

Your body naturally goes through all of these huge changes that would affect your body after you give birth, which is not your fault. There are going to be stretch marks, loose skin, tears in the dermis that are irreversible, and poor posture and back pain. 

Since your breast is going to start producing milk and your breast tissues could loosen and they may appear lower after you stop breastfeeding. This would make it sag, but you could get a few procedures to help with that, like breast augmentation, breast lift, or a combination of both.

You are also going to have some small fat deposits that would not disappear no matter how many diets you try and how often you need to exercise. Having this fat is natural since it’s a way for you to feed the baby, so it’s something you really can’t avoid sometimes.

It’s all done in one surgery

The reason why a lot of women choose to get a mommy makeover, it’s because everything is all done in just one surgery. This means that you are going to only have to pay for one anesthesia fee, one facility fee, and one procedure for recovery. This would be able to save you time and money.

How Long is the Recovery Period?

How long your recovery would take would depend on the procedures you are getting done and how many procedures at the same time you are getting. Usually, you are going to have to take at least 2 to 3 weeks off of work but if your procedures are less extensive, then you could maybe return back in a week or two. This period is also considered as stage 1 of plastic surgery recovery when you may be recommended to wear compression garments to lessen swelling and bruising.

When you are talking about full recovery, you are usually going to have to wait about 3 to 4 months before you are considered that you are fully recovered but you would be able to see the full results in about 6 to 12 months because there is going to be swelling and tissue healing to be done during those times.
